About SIDS and Kids ACT
History
The Sudden Infant Death Association for the ACT and Southern Districts now known as SIDS and Kids, was formed in 1978 by a group of parents whose children had died through Sudden Infant Death Syndrome.
Since 1999 SIDS and Kids supports the familes of all children who die suddenly and unexpectedly from 20 weeks gestation through to six years of age regardless of cause. The children may have died from stillbirth, SIDS, neonatal death, drowning, fire, motor vehicle accident, a fast onset illness or some other way. In 2002 the former SANDS ACT organisation joined SIDS and Kids to assist providing volunteer peer support to families affected by stillbirth or neonatal death.
